Web Browsers at the Center: 44% of Security Incidents Identified in 2025 Unit 42 Report

MUMBAI, India, 28 March 2025—Palo Alto Networks, the global cybersecurity leader, released the 2025 Unit 42 Global Incident Response Report, which found that threat actors are now evolving their tactics, moving beyond traditional ransomware and data theft to focus on business disruption, AI-assisted attacks, and insider threats. According to the report, almost half of the security incidents (44%) involved a web browser.

 The Indian government recently revealed that cyber fraud cases jumped over four-fold in FY2024, causing US$ 20 million (177 crores) in losses. These cases have varied from deepfake scams, and voice cloning scams, to phishing scams and more, causing loss of important data along with fiscal troubles.

 Recognising the dire need for stronger cybersecurity defence, the Indian government allocated over 1,900 crores for cybersecurity initiatives and projects in the Union Budget 2025, a whopping increase of 18% as compared to 1,600 crores allocated in the last budget.

 As financial institutions, healthcare providers, and government agencies across the globe face an unprecedented and ever-evolving cyber threat landscape, regional regulators are strengthening Zero Trust frameworks, adopting AI-powered security solutions, and enforcing stricter compliance measures.

 The shift from financial extortion to full-scale business disruption means enterprises must rethink their cyber defences before an attack happens, particularly in sectors that rely on cloud and third-party vendors.

 The 2025 Unit 42 Global Incident Response Report, which analysed hundreds of major cyber incidents, aims to highlight how the increased sophistication of malicious actors is amplifying the challenges faced by businesses worldwide.

 Key findings of the 2025 Unit 42 Incident Response Report include:

  •  Operational Disruption as a Primary Goal: Attackers are prioritising sabotage over data theft, aiming to cripple businesses and maximize extortion. In 2024, 86% of incidents led to operational downtime or reputational damage.
  • Surge in Insider Threats Linked to North Korea: Cases tripled in 2024, with operatives targeting contract-based technical roles at major tech firms, financial services, media, and government defense contractors. Advanced techniques, including hardware-based KVM-over-IP devices and Visual Studio Code tunneling, make detection more challenging.
  • Accelerated Data Exfiltration: Attackers are exfiltrating data three times faster than in 2021, with 25% of cases seeing data stolen within five hours, and nearly 20% occurring in under an hour.
  • Expanded Attack Surfaces: 70% of incidents involved three or more attack vectors, underscoring the need for comprehensive security across endpoints, networks, cloud environments, and human vulnerabilities. Web browsers remain a weak link, facilitating 44% of attacks via phishing, malicious redirects, and malware downloads.
  • Phishing Resurges as Top Entry Point: 23% of attacks began with phishing, overtaking vulnerabilities as the leading attack vector. GenAI has made phishing campaigns more scalable, sophisticated, and difficult to detect.

inDrive has pioneered the ‘Set your Fare and Choose your Driver’ in India. This model allows passengers to decide the price, driver, and type of vehicle, irrespective of the smartphone model, battery time, and other parameters. This is unlike other ride-hailing services, where AI models and algorithms determine pricing.

Incorporated in 2010, Tembo Global Industries stands as a prominent entity in the industrial sector, specializing in the production and assembly of metal components for Pipe Support Systems, Fasteners, Anchors, HVAC, Anti-Vibration Systems, and Equipment for a range of installations including industrial, commercial, utility, and OEM. The company also engages in the trade of metal products that complement its manufacturing operations. The Company is a fabrication and installation specialist in ductile pipes, HDB pipes and fittings, and MS plate. Its products are certified and approved by Underwriter’s Laboratory Inc. (USA) and FM Approval (USA) for Fire Sprinkler System Installations. As an export-driven enterprise, Tembo has earned the distinction of a 2 Star Export House. In 2023, Tembo ventured into the EPC (Engineering, Procurement, and Construction) contracting arena, securing orders from prestigious infrastructure clients. Additionally, the Company has interests in the textile trading market. In 2024, the Company further diversified into manufacturing of defence products and entered into solar power.
